The Evolution of Robotic Vacuums

The concept of a robotic vacuum dates back to the late 20th century, however it wasn’t up until the early 2000s that these gadgets became commercially feasible. The first commonly recognized robotic vacuum, the iRobot Roomba, was introduced in 2002. Ever since, the technology has advanced considerably, with modern designs featuring sophisticated navigation systems, powerful suction, and smart home integration.

Key Milestones:

  1. 2002: Introduction of the iRobot Roomba – The very first commercially effective robotic vacuum.
  2. 2005: Advanced Navigation – Integration of infrared sensing units and cliff detection to prevent falls.
  3. 2010: Wi-Fi Connectivity – Allowing push-button control and scheduling through mobile phone apps.
  4. 2015: Mapping and Zoning – Advanced mapping technology for more effective cleaning.
  5. 2020: AI and Machine Learning – Enhanced navigation and cleaning patterns through synthetic intelligence.

How Robotic Vacuums Work

Robotic vacuums run utilizing a mix of sensing units, algorithms, and motors. Here’s a breakdown of the crucial elements and processes:

  1. Sensors: These consist of infrared, ultrasonic, and optical sensing units that assist the vacuum identify barriers, edges, and dirt. Some designs likewise use cams for visual mapping.
  2. Mapping and Navigation: Advanced models use S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) innovation to develop a map of the cleaning area and navigate efficiently.
  3. Suction and Brushes: Robotic vacuums use powerful motors to develop suction and numerous brushes to get dirt and debris. Some models consist of side brushes to reach into corners.
  4. Battery and Charging: Most robotic vacuums are geared up with rechargeable lithium-ion batteries. They go back to their charging dock when the battery is low.
  5. Smart Home Integration: Many designs can be controlled via smart device apps, voice ass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ant, and can be incorporated into smart home systems.

Benefits of Robotic Vacuums

  1. Convenience: One of the most substantial benefits is the convenience of hands-free cleaning. Users can set up cleanings or start them remotely, allowing for a tidy home without the effort.
  2. Effectiveness: Modern robotic vacuums are designed to clean effectively, covering large areas and browsing around obstacles with ease.
  3. Long-Term Savings: While the preliminary cost may be greater, the long-term savings on manual cleaning tools and the time conserved can be substantial.
  4. Allergic reaction Relief: Regular cleaning can help in reducing irritants in the home, making it an advantageous investment for allergy patients.
  5. Eco-Friendly: Many models are energy-efficient and use recyclable materials, making them a more sustainable cleaning alternative.

Future Trends in Robotic Vacuums

The future of robotic vacuums is appealing, with continuous advancements in technology. Some patterns to look for include:

  1. Enhanced AI and Machine Learning: More advanced algorithms will enable much better navigation, barrier avoidance, and cleaning efficiency.
  2. Integration with Smart Home Ecosystems: Increased compatibility with numerous smart home devices and platforms.
  3. Improved Battery Life: Longer-lasting batteries to cover bigger locations without requiring to charge.
  4. Multi-Functionality: Beyond vacuuming, future designs might include extra functions like air purification and surface area cleaning.

Frequently asked questions

Q: Are robotic vacuums as efficient as traditional vacuums?A: While they might not be as powerful as high-end traditional vacuums, contemporary robotic vacuums are extremely reliable for regular cleaning jobs. They are particularly useful for preserving a tidy home in between deep cleans.

Q: How frequently should I clean the filters and brushes?A: It is recommended to clean the filters and brushes after every couple of usages to ensure ideal efficiency. Speak with the user manual for specific upkeep directions.

Q: Can robotic vacuums browse stairs?A: Most robotic vacuums are equipped with cliff sensors that prevent them from falling down stairs. However, they are not developed to clean stairs.

Q: Are robotic vacuums loud?A: Generally, robotic vacuums are quieter than traditional vacuums. Nevertheless, noise levels can differ by model. Some designs use peaceful cleaning modes for nighttime use.
